> You can get 8 null directions from just two loops simply by adding two
> DPDT relays to the "outdoor box". If you connect the two loops in series,
> the result will be a funny looking two-turn loop with an average winding
> plane that is at +45 degrees to the physical loops. Then reverse the
> polarity of one of the loops and youl'll get -45 degrees. Together with
> the original configuration, this brings you nulls in N-NE-E-SE-S-SW-W-NW.
>
> My antenna works great on LF but sometimes behaves a little bit
> strange in the upper half of the MW band. Probably because the loop
> wire length becomes a considerable fraction of a wavelength. Could
> have something to do with angle of arrival too, I guess...
>
> Oh, I almost forgot, the termination has to be adjusted slightly when
> switching between "normal" and "45 deg" null directions.
